We made a difficult leap from another area preschool (with a play-based curriculum, but light on the curriculum) after two years because our older kid was right on the K cutoff for birthdays and we felt like we really wanted him to be prepared when he entered K at almost-6. It was hard to leave the known thing and plunge into the unknown, but as soon as I walked into PSA and got my tour from Sandy, I knew we had to make the switch. First of all, did you know a church basement could feel like the children's corner at a well-loved library? Well, it can. The joy and care and connection that PSA inspires can be felt immediately upon entry. They showed me their monthly themes that span across classes and ages but which increase in sophistication as a child develops and I was impressed with the level of organization and administrative support something like curriculum mapping requires (having taught middle school and high school, these little details meant a lot to me--both in knowing there were clearly defined expectations for what was being taught and when for my kids' sake, but that also staff had a basic structure scaffolding their teaching that allowed for coherence and also professional latitude in how the themes were taught. It was also very clear that the school was communicating with and including families in meaningful ways, which was a huge sticking point for me at the last school. For the price tag, which wasn't much more than we were already paying, I knew I had to try it out. To my surprise and delight, PSA overdelivers on their original promises in their "sales pitch" meeting, which I did not see coming. For two years I was part of the closest-knit, best-run, loving, creative, and artful community that set the bar for what I've come to expect from my kids' learning community. Not only did my kids get the 3 R's and come out of PSA overprepared for kindergarten, but they got fine arts, music education, multicultural holiday celebration and education, swimming lessons at the Y during summer camp, a senior prom, a senior art show where a classroom is turned into an art gallery displaying kid work/ artist-studies from the year, a graduation that feels like the event of the year, The Lizard Guy, add on after school extracurriculars, a Halloween parade, a PRIDE FESTIVAL (big one for me and my fam), and a community of friends that continue to be our family's people two years out and hopefully will be forever. Extra shout out to Mr. Lucas who single-handedly created an afterschool art club by accident and instilled a love of drawing and learning through community for our oldest kid and his friends and also to Ms. Carmel who brought in 200 pounds of sand into her classroom and created a serious beach party for our younger kid. The Parent Alliance Committee is incredibly robust and active and makes sure families feel included, heard, and part of a meaningful community. Administration is attentive and professional, teachers are beyond qualified and incredibly loving, their social media presence has been known to make parents cry in the middle of a random workday. The school is one exciting educational opportunity after another. The parents and kids ROCK. What more could you ask for?

Evan Greenberg
18:31 12 Jun 23
Both of my daughters have attend PSA for the past three years and we have had a fantastic experience. Firstly, in my experience, there is an extremely limited number of preschools in the area that offer full-time care and PSA is one of them. The curriculum is play-based and grounded in "The Nurtured Heart" model, which means it's all about building empathy and compassion in the kids. The facilities convey a heart warming sense of community, which is obviously a core value of the organization. As stakeholders, have always felt seen and heard by the administration. Most importantly though, the PSA teachers are incredibly caring and devoted to their important roles in the children's lives. It shows up in everything they do; from the authentic joy on their faces when they greet the kids each morning to the loyalty with which they hold these positions for many many years, to the way they address us during their extremely informative bi-annual parent / teacher conferences. The teachers at Park Street Academy truly care and that makes all the difference.
